Ticket #—Fire-Drill Roll Call, Ashgrove Site

Priority: Medium

Drill scheduled Thursday 10:30, Muster Point C (rear car park). Facilities to bring the roll-call tablet, hi-vis vests, and the printed floor registers. Wardens for Levels 2 and 4 still unconfirmed — chase by Wednesday noon. Note: turnstile logs must be exported before the alarm sounds, or the headcount won't reconcile. To pull the export at the gatehouse panel, use the supervisor pass below.

badge for yajep-tawip: bdg-UBYAH-39947

Ticket: Vault locked mid-parity work — Fernwhistle SDKs. For the eng sync: I was closing the feature gap between the Kotlin and Swift clients (batch uploads and offline queueing) when the shared test-credentials vault locked me out after a token expiry. Parity branch is pushed and green except the two vault-dependent suites. Whoever picks this up, unlock the vault and rerun those. Unlock takes the passphrase below.

strongbox words: ulaael-wenix

**Key Ceremony Checklist — Item 7: Webhook Retries (Ottergate)**

Quick one: confirm Ottergate's webhook retries use exponential backoff, capped at five attempts, and that delivery receipts are signed with the ceremony key. If the signer's offline, failed deliveries park in the hold queue. To re-arm the signer afterward, you'll need the passphrase listed right below.

unlock words, kagef-taduf: fenir-quenix-norwyn-sorvan-gormir-gorir-fraok

## Snapshot testing your Glimmerkit components

Plugin authors must run the snapshot suite against the reference renderer before publishing. Snapshots are byte-compared, so ensure your local environment matches the harness exactly: font hinting, device pixel ratio, and locale all affect output. Flaky diffs are almost always caused by mismatched renderer settings rather than genuine regressions, so verify your setup first and regenerate baselines only after a confirmed visual change. The harness expects the following configuration values.

settings of yahag-yafog:
[pramir]
host = pramir.qirvancorp.internal
user = pramir_svc
database = pramir_prod